About the Provider

Description: Bear Hollow Early Learning Center is a Child Care Center in NOBLE OK, with a maximum capacity of 28 children. This child care center helps with children in the age range of 0 - 11 Months, 12 - 23 Months, 2 Years, 3 Years, 4 Years, 5 Years, 6 Years and Older. The provider does not participate in a subsidized child care program.

Additional Information: Rated 1 Stars.

2018-07-24 Periodic
Full Inspection
Plan: Will maintain safe sleep requirements at all times, and entire facility will retake Safe Sleep training. Bottle and blanket removed from cribs during visit.
Correction Date: 2018-07-23
Description: 340:110-3-296(b)(2)(B)(iii) - Soft products, such as quilts, comforters, sheepskins, pillows, stuffed toys, and bumper pads are prohibited inside and on the side of infant rest equipment.

First infant had a blanket in the crib with them, another infant in the crib by the wall had a bottle in the crib with them.

2018-07-24 Periodic
Full Inspection
Plan: Will only bottle feed infants in a designated eating area. Bottle was removed from the crib during the visit.
Correction Date: 2018-07-23
Description: 340:110-3-298(f)(8)(A) - has a designated eating and drinking location, excluding rest equipment and equipment with motion, such as swings; and

Infant had a bottle with milk in it in the crib with them.
